Re: Morales, Hamed, Barrera, Jones and McKinney: Who Was the Best at 122lbs in the 90s Decade?
Hamed never fought for a world title in super bantams, Morales came way too late (debuted 1993, relevant at all only starting from 1995 - so half a decade), Kennedy McKinney comes behind Vuyani Bungu in any criteria (lost twice to head-to-head, shorter title reign too). Junior Jones had a very brief career in super bantams - basically just 6 fights.
With all those guys disqualified from discussion, I'd say that the top 3 super bantams of 90's in reference to their ACHIEVEMENTS were Barrera, Wilfredo Vazquez and Daniel Zaragoza.
